Output 8e76763c225caacee524cbd4bc7c76d2f2e4bef8b0cb6575f1e17eeb2bc57d5e: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d53cd95cedd03f767361b8d555a6bc7e7a616b87 OP_EQUAL
address
3M8WkGhLzTBRB1hxkW4824H8o2AKV7dAKb
transaction
8e76763c225caacee524cbd4bc7c76d2f2e4bef8b0cb6575f1e17eeb2bc57d5e
spent
true